Where is the user Startup folder in Windows 10?

Accessing The Windows 10 Startup Folder
  1. The All Users Startup Folder is located at the following path: C:ProgramDataMicrosoftWindowsStart MenuProgramsStartUp.
  2. The Current User Startup Folder is located here: C:Users[User Name]AppDataRoamingMicrosoftWindowsStart MenuProgramsStartup.

Similarly, you may ask, how do I find the Startup folder in Windows 10?

Windows 10 startup folder location. These programs start up for the current logged in user only. To directly access this folder, open Run, type shell:startup and hit Enter. Or to quickly open the folder, press WinKey, type shell:startup and hit Enter.

Does Windows 10 have a Startup folder?

Shortcut to the Windows 10 Startup Folder To quickly access the All Users Startup Folder in Windows 10, open the Run dialog box (Windows Key + R), type shell:common startup, and click OK. A new File Explorer Window will open displaying the All Users Startup Folder.

Why can't I disable startup programs Windows 10?

Some startup items have no shortcut in the Startup folder. You can disable these with either the Startup tasks tool in Settings or the Task Manager in Windows 10 and 8. x, or the System Configuration Utility ( msconfig.exe ) in Windows 7. Otherwise, they are only accessible through the registry.

How do I change what programs run at startup?

Change which apps run automatically at startup in Windows 10
  1. Select the Start button, then select Settings > Apps > Startup. Make sure any app you want to run at startup is turned On.
  2. If you don't see the Startup option in Settings, right-click the Start button, select Task Manager, then select the Startup tab. (If you don't see the Startup tab, select More details.)

How do I turn off programs at startup?

How To Disable Startup Programs In Windows 7 and Vista
  1. Click the Start Menu Orb then in the search box Type MSConfig and Press Enter or Click the msconfig.exe program link.
  2. From within the System Configuration tool, Click Startup tab and then Uncheck the program boxes that you would like to prevent from starting when Windows starts.

How do I stop Microsoft teams from opening on startup?

You can disable Microsoft Teams from Task Manager and it will not start up automatically:
  1. Press Ctrl + Shift + Esc key to open Task Manager.
  2. Go to Startup tab.
  3. Click on Microsoft Teams, and click on Disable.

How do I get to advanced startup options in Windows 10?

If you can access Desktop
  1. All you need to do is hold down the Shift key on your keyboard and restart the PC.
  2. Open up the Start menu and click on “Power” button to open power options.
  3. Now press and hold the Shift key and click on “Restart”.
  4. Windows will automatically start in advanced boot options after a short delay.

How do I turn off startup programs in Windows 10?

Step 1 Right-click on an empty area on the Taskbar and select Task Manager. Step 2 When Task Manager comes up, click the Startup tab and look through the list of programs that are enabled to run during startup. Then to stop them from running, right-click the program and select Disable.
